Position Summary:
The Behavioral Health Associate serves as an integral part of the multidisciplinary treatment team and is responsible for monitoring and reporting of patient behaviors; providing continuous patient care, supervision, interaction, and role modeling; assisting in patient data collection, recording, and maintenance; and responding in crisis situations and emergencies as needed.
Essential Job Functions:
- Ensures the well-being of patients and provides a safe, positive, supportive, and structured environment. Maintains a constant awareness and supervision of patients
- Interacts routinely with patients, observes behaviors, and communicates significant observations to group therapist and supervisor.
- Intervene appropriately with patients experiencing a behavioral crisis situation, i.e., suicidal, threatening behavior, elopement and/or other situations, using approved interventions.
- Provide education in accordance with patient weekly schedule under supervision of Clinical Director.
- Participate with the treatment team in implementation of the individualized plan of care. Report factors that may impede successful accomplishment of the treatment plan to group therapist and supervisor.
- Assists in the admission and discharge of patient.
